Frequently Asked Questions about Port Richmond Apartments with Hardwood Floors

What is the Cheapest Hardwood Floors apartment in Port Richmond?

Currently the most affordable Apartment in Port Richmond with Hardwood Floors is at The Pump House listed at $1,000.

How much is the average rent for Port Richmond Apartments with Hardwood Floors?

The average rent for a Apartment in Port Richmond with Hardwood Floors is $2,211.

What is the largest Port Richmond Apartment for rent with Hardwood Floors?

Today's Apartment with Hardwood Floors and the most square footage in Port Richmond is a 2,295 square feet unit starting from $2,295 at 1822 E Glenwood Ave.

What is the average size for Port Richmond Apartments for rent with Hardwood Floors?

The average size for a rental with Hardwood Floors in Port Richmond is currently at 644 sq ft.
